What is a dermal filler treatment?

A dermal filler treatment is a cosmetic procedure that involves injecting a substance, usually a gel-like substance, into the skin to add volume, smooth out wrinkles, and enhance facial features. Dermal fillers are commonly used to treat signs of aging, such as fine lines, wrinkles, and loss of volume in the face. They can also be used to enhance the lips, cheeks, and other facial areas. The procedure is minimally invasive and provides immediate results, making it a popular choice for those looking to rejuvenate their appearance. However, it is important to consult with a qualified and experienced professional before undergoing a dermal filler treatment to ensure safety and achieve the desired results.

Pre-Treatment Instructions

Avoid blood-thinning medications

When preparing for a dermal filler treatment, it is important to avoid blood-thinning medications. These medications can increase the risk of bruising and bleeding during the procedure. It is recommended to consult with your healthcare provider about any medications you are currently taking and whether they should be temporarily stopped prior to the treatment. By avoiding blood-thinning medications, you can help ensure a smoother and safer dermal filler experience.

Avoid alcohol and smoking

Before undergoing a dermal filler treatment, it is important to avoid alcohol and smoking. Alcohol and smoking can have negative effects on the skin and can interfere with the healing process. Alcohol can dehydrate the skin and make it more prone to bruising and swelling. Smoking, on the other hand, can restrict blood flow to the skin, which can delay the healing process and increase the risk of complications. By avoiding alcohol and smoking, you can help ensure optimal results from your dermal filler treatment and promote a faster and smoother recovery.

Avoid sun exposure and tanning

One important step to take before a dermal filler treatment is to avoid sun exposure and tanning. Sun exposure can increase the risk of complications during and after the treatment, such as inflammation and hyperpigmentation. It is recommended to stay out of direct sunlight for at least two weeks prior to the treatment and to use sunscreen with a high SPF to protect the skin. Tanning beds should also be avoided as they can have similar effects on the skin. By avoiding sun exposure and tanning, you can help ensure a smoother and more successful dermal filler treatment.

Potential side effects and risks

When it comes to dermal filler treatments, it is important to be aware of the potential side effects and risks. While dermal fillers are generally safe and well-tolerated, there are some potential risks that should be considered. Common side effects include temporary redness, swelling, and bruising at the injection site. In rare cases, more serious side effects such as infection, allergic reactions, or vascular complications may occur. It is crucial to choose a qualified and experienced practitioner who follows proper injection techniques to minimize the risk of complications. Additionally, discussing your medical history and any allergies with your practitioner beforehand can help ensure a safe and successful treatment. Overall, being informed about the potential side effects and risks can help you make an educated decision and have a positive experience with dermal filler treatments.

Post-Treatment Care

Avoid touching or rubbing the treated area

After receiving a dermal filler treatment, it is important to avoid touching or rubbing the treated area. Touching or rubbing the area can disrupt the placement of the filler and potentially cause complications. It is recommended to refrain from any contact with the treated area for at least 24 hours to allow the filler to settle properly. This includes avoiding any pressure or friction on the skin, such as sleeping on the treated side or applying excessive makeup. Following this precautionary measure will help ensure optimal results and minimize the risk of any adverse reactions.

Apply cold compress to reduce swelling

Applying a cold compress is an effective way to reduce swelling after a dermal filler treatment. The cold temperature helps constrict the blood vessels, reducing inflammation and minimizing any potential swelling. To apply a cold compress, you can use a clean cloth or an ice pack wrapped in a thin towel. Gently place the compress on the treated area for about 10-15 minutes at a time, taking short breaks in between. It is important to avoid direct contact of the cold compress with the skin to prevent frostbite. By incorporating this simple step into your post-treatment routine, you can help promote faster healing and achieve optimal results.
